Transaction 8346823be37103dfa4970e77d701053ce61e52b9d262e10b19f717adc38988e4

2 Input
2 Outputs
  • 8346823be37103dfa4970e77d701053ce61e52b9d262e10b19f717adc38988e4:0
  • value  60801436
    address  33gZpVpeuJdyN1PEJZVVTYBhAQNqL8jMPW
  • 8346823be37103dfa4970e77d701053ce61e52b9d262e10b19f717adc38988e4:1
  • value  42628704
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n